Low voltage technician needs a strong blend of technical, problem-solving, and soft skills, including knowledge of electronics, wiring, and blueprints; troubleshooting and diagnostic abilities; and communication, attention to detail, and safety consciousness. They must also be adaptable and have a good work ethic to stay current with technology and manage their tasks.
